| Specification | GPT-5.4 Nano | GPT-5.5 |
|---|---|---|
| Provider | OpenAI | OpenAI |
| Tier | Budget | Frontier |
| Context window | 400K | Winner: 1.05M |
| Max output | 128K | 128K |
| Input / 1M tokens | Winner: $0.20 | $5 |
| Output / 1M tokens | Winner: $1.25 | $30 |
| Weights | Closed | Closed |
| Parameters | Not disclosedUnverified | Not disclosedUnverified |
| Reasoning levels | none, low, medium, high | none, low, medium, high, xhigh, max |
| Modalities | text, image | text, image |
| API model id | gpt-5.4-nano | gpt-5.5 |
| Released | March 17, 2026 | April 23, 2026 |
| Artificial Analysis Intelligence Index [high] (2026-08-14) | 40 | Not verifiedUnverified |
| Artificial Analysis Intelligence Index [xhigh] (2026-08-14) | Not verifiedUnverified | 58 |
| SWE-bench Verified (2026-09-01) | Not verifiedUnverified | 82.6 |
| Terminal-Bench 2.1 (2026-07-27) | Not verifiedUnverified | 83.4 |
| GPQA Diamond (2026-07-27) | Not verifiedUnverified | 93.5 |
| Humanity's Last Exam (2026-04-23) | Not verifiedUnverified | 52.2 |
Prices are USD per million tokens at standard rates, excluding batch and caching discounts. Bold indicates the better figure where one is objectively better. Values we could not confirm from the provider are shown as “Not verified” rather than estimated.

When the cheaper one wins
GPT-5.4 Nano is cheaper on output at $1.25 per million tokens against $30 for GPT-5.5 — about 24×. Use the cheaper tier for classification, extraction, summarisation, and any task where the expensive model’s extra score does not change the accepted output. The expensive one only pays if your hardest task actually fails on the cheap tier. These are standard-tier API rates, excluding batch and cache discounts.

Which has the larger context window, GPT-5.4 Nano or GPT-5.5?
GPT-5.5 accepts 1.05M tokens against 400K for GPT-5.4 Nano. This only matters if you routinely send very long documents or large codebases.
Do GPT-5.4 Nano and GPT-5.5 support the same reasoning levels?
GPT-5.4 Nano exposes none, low, medium, high, while GPT-5.5 exposes none, low, medium, high, xhigh, max.
Should I use GPT-5.4 Nano or GPT-5.5?
GPT-5.4 Nano is the budget tier and GPT-5.5 the frontier tier. The useful question is whether your hardest task actually fails on the cheaper one — most production volume such as classification, extraction and summarisation does not.
